Please DO NOT QUOTE this post in your reply. Just post your questions or comments if you have any. I DON'T CHECK OR RESPOND TO PM'S.
Proof of Concept:
Sprint Samsung Galaxy S4's & Note 3's that have been flashed to Sprint legacy accounts such as SERO or Sprint MVNO's such as Boost, Virgin Mobile, Ting, etc. suffer from the fact that you can't launch Update Profile / Update PRL unless the phone has been previously activated in a Sprint LTE account. If the phone has been factory reset using ##786#, the user will also lose the ability to run Update Profile/PRL. As a side effect, you will also get a Hands Free Activation nag each time you turn on/reboot your phone. Disabling/freezing certain apk's to fix the HFA nag unfortunately breaks the phone's ability to run Update Profile & PRL as well. The fix below gets rid of the HFA nag and enables Update Profile & PRL on flashed Sprint Samsung Galaxy S4 & Note 3 phones.
If you'd like to thank me, please click on the "Thanks" button instead of posting a thank you note. Let's save storage and bandwidth. And please, please, please...DO NOT QUOTE THIS POST IN YOUR REPLY JUST TO THANK ME! Again for those who don't know me, I do not accept personal donations. Instead I encourage you to donate to the American Cancer Society, to your local church, or any other not for profit charities.
What good is running Update Profile anyway?
1) This will automatically correct your MDN and MIN settings on your phone if they were flashed incorrectly.
2) This will automatically correct the Profile 1 (or Profile 2) username and AAA key to get your 3G working.
This fix assumes the following:
1) You have a rooted phone. I've only tested on a TouchWiz-based rooted ROM (Sacs Custom ROM based on Android 4.3 on the S4 and stock rooted 4.3 on the Note 3). Post #44 reports that this doesn't work on Android 4.4.2.
2) You have access to another Sprint Galaxy S4 or Note 3 in which Update Profile/PRL already works. Let's call this phone "SOURCE". In theory once you have the appropriate files from "SOURCE", you can use these same files over and over.
3) You're looking to get Update Profile/PRL to work on another phone that is already flashed to Sprint (or Sprint MVNO). This will not work for any other provider! Let's call this phone "TARGET".
4) You have a spare microSD card to transfer files between "SOURCE" and "TARGET" phones.
5) You have flashed your "TARGET" phone's MDN and MIN using DFS, CDMA Workshop, etc.
6) You have flashed your "TARGET" phone's Profile 0 and Profile 1 using DFS, CDMA Workshop, etc.
7) Profile 0 must be accurately flashed. Profile 1's username can be flashed using a bogus value such as "johndoe@sprintpcs.com" if you do not know the actual username.
8) If you removed/disabled/froze system apk's / apps in your phone to get rid of the Hands Free Activation nag previously, make sure you put these back in their original state.
9) You have the ability to reflash your S4 or Note 3 back to Boost, Ting, Virgin Mobile, etc. in case your flash gets wiped out cuz you didn't follow the directions closely.
Steps to fix Update Profile / Update PRL: (idea is to copy SOURCE phone's /carrier directory to TARGET phone)
1) Use a root-enabled file explorer app such as Root Explorer or ES File Explorer to backup the /carrier directory from your "TARGET" phone to a microSD card.
2) Rename this /carrier folder in the microSD card to something like /carrierBackup.
3) Use the file explorer app to copy the /carrier directory from your "SOURCE" phone to the microSD card as well. Insert this microSD card to your "TARGET" phone.
4) Copy the contents of /carrier directory from microSD card to your "TARGET" phone. Overwrite the files that may already exist in your "TARGET" phone's /carrier directory.
5) Reboot the "TARGET" phone.
6) Run "Update Profile" or "Update PRL".
7) Done.
OR...Instead of doing steps 3 and 4, simply use ES File Explorer to unzip contents of attached carrier-GS4.zip OR carrier-Note3.zip file in /carrier so that the files/folders would look like the attached screen shots.
Pay attention to the content in the screenshots as well as file/folder permissions to make sure they match!
WARNING: DO NOT USE WINDOWS TO COPY/EXTRACT FILES TO/FROM PHONE. IT WILL OMIT THE HIDDEN FILE CHAMELEON.HASH. YOUR BOOST/TING/VIRGIN MOBILE/ETC FLASH WILL GET WIPED OUT IF THE CONTENTS OF YOUR /CARRIER FOLDER DON'T MATCH THE SCREENSHOTS BELOW.
Reboot the phone and perform an Update Profile.
The screen shots attached are contents of /carrier folder of "SOURCE" Sprint Galaxy S4 phone.
Give it a try and let me know if it worked for you and what phone(s) you used.
If you'd like to thank me, please click on the "Thanks" button instead of posting a thank you note. Let's save storage and bandwidth. And please, please, please...DO NOT QUOTE THIS POST IN YOUR REPLY JUST TO THANK ME! Again for those who don't know me, I do not accept personal donations. Instead I encourage you to donate to the American Cancer Society, to your local church, or any other not for profit charities.
Proof of Concept:
Sprint Samsung Galaxy S4's & Note 3's that have been flashed to Sprint legacy accounts such as SERO or Sprint MVNO's such as Boost, Virgin Mobile, Ting, etc. suffer from the fact that you can't launch Update Profile / Update PRL unless the phone has been previously activated in a Sprint LTE account. If the phone has been factory reset using ##786#, the user will also lose the ability to run Update Profile/PRL. As a side effect, you will also get a Hands Free Activation nag each time you turn on/reboot your phone. Disabling/freezing certain apk's to fix the HFA nag unfortunately breaks the phone's ability to run Update Profile & PRL as well. The fix below gets rid of the HFA nag and enables Update Profile & PRL on flashed Sprint Samsung Galaxy S4 & Note 3 phones.
If you'd like to thank me, please click on the "Thanks" button instead of posting a thank you note. Let's save storage and bandwidth. And please, please, please...DO NOT QUOTE THIS POST IN YOUR REPLY JUST TO THANK ME! Again for those who don't know me, I do not accept personal donations. Instead I encourage you to donate to the American Cancer Society, to your local church, or any other not for profit charities.
What good is running Update Profile anyway?
1) This will automatically correct your MDN and MIN settings on your phone if they were flashed incorrectly.
2) This will automatically correct the Profile 1 (or Profile 2) username and AAA key to get your 3G working.
This fix assumes the following:
1) You have a rooted phone. I've only tested on a TouchWiz-based rooted ROM (Sacs Custom ROM based on Android 4.3 on the S4 and stock rooted 4.3 on the Note 3). Post #44 reports that this doesn't work on Android 4.4.2.
2) You have access to another Sprint Galaxy S4 or Note 3 in which Update Profile/PRL already works. Let's call this phone "SOURCE". In theory once you have the appropriate files from "SOURCE", you can use these same files over and over.
3) You're looking to get Update Profile/PRL to work on another phone that is already flashed to Sprint (or Sprint MVNO). This will not work for any other provider! Let's call this phone "TARGET".
4) You have a spare microSD card to transfer files between "SOURCE" and "TARGET" phones.
5) You have flashed your "TARGET" phone's MDN and MIN using DFS, CDMA Workshop, etc.
6) You have flashed your "TARGET" phone's Profile 0 and Profile 1 using DFS, CDMA Workshop, etc.
7) Profile 0 must be accurately flashed. Profile 1's username can be flashed using a bogus value such as "johndoe@sprintpcs.com" if you do not know the actual username.
8) If you removed/disabled/froze system apk's / apps in your phone to get rid of the Hands Free Activation nag previously, make sure you put these back in their original state.
9) You have the ability to reflash your S4 or Note 3 back to Boost, Ting, Virgin Mobile, etc. in case your flash gets wiped out cuz you didn't follow the directions closely.
Steps to fix Update Profile / Update PRL: (idea is to copy SOURCE phone's /carrier directory to TARGET phone)
1) Use a root-enabled file explorer app such as Root Explorer or ES File Explorer to backup the /carrier directory from your "TARGET" phone to a microSD card.
2) Rename this /carrier folder in the microSD card to something like /carrierBackup.
3) Use the file explorer app to copy the /carrier directory from your "SOURCE" phone to the microSD card as well. Insert this microSD card to your "TARGET" phone.
4) Copy the contents of /carrier directory from microSD card to your "TARGET" phone. Overwrite the files that may already exist in your "TARGET" phone's /carrier directory.
5) Reboot the "TARGET" phone.
6) Run "Update Profile" or "Update PRL".
7) Done.
OR...Instead of doing steps 3 and 4, simply use ES File Explorer to unzip contents of attached carrier-GS4.zip OR carrier-Note3.zip file in /carrier so that the files/folders would look like the attached screen shots.
Pay attention to the content in the screenshots as well as file/folder permissions to make sure they match!
WARNING: DO NOT USE WINDOWS TO COPY/EXTRACT FILES TO/FROM PHONE. IT WILL OMIT THE HIDDEN FILE CHAMELEON.HASH. YOUR BOOST/TING/VIRGIN MOBILE/ETC FLASH WILL GET WIPED OUT IF THE CONTENTS OF YOUR /CARRIER FOLDER DON'T MATCH THE SCREENSHOTS BELOW.
Reboot the phone and perform an Update Profile.
The screen shots attached are contents of /carrier folder of "SOURCE" Sprint Galaxy S4 phone.
Give it a try and let me know if it worked for you and what phone(s) you used.
If you'd like to thank me, please click on the "Thanks" button instead of posting a thank you note. Let's save storage and bandwidth. And please, please, please...DO NOT QUOTE THIS POST IN YOUR REPLY JUST TO THANK ME! Again for those who don't know me, I do not accept personal donations. Instead I encourage you to donate to the American Cancer Society, to your local church, or any other not for profit charities.
Attachments
-
Screenshot_2014-01-28-15-36-20.jpg121.2 KB · Views: 12,203
-
Screenshot_2014-01-28-15-36-32.png140.9 KB · Views: 11,226
-
Screenshot_2014-01-28-15-36-47.png165.2 KB · Views: 10,714
-
Screenshot_2014-01-28-15-36-55.jpg151.5 KB · Views: 9,309
-
Screenshot_2014-01-28-15-37-02.jpg143.9 KB · Views: 9,113
-
carrier-GS4.zip18 KB · Views: 3,277
-
carrier-Note3.zip4.6 MB · Views: 4,047
-
carrier-Mega.zip12.8 KB · Views: 1,365
Last edited: